How does the slow melting ice impact the ecosystem in the Arctic region?

The slow melting ice in the Arctic region impacts the ecosystem by disrupting the habitats of animals like polar bears and seals, reducing food sources for marine life, and contributing to rising sea levels and changes in global climate patterns.
